The Woodsman is a captivating and thought-provoking movie that delves into the complex theme of redemption and the human capacity for change. Released in 2004, this independent drama film offers viewers a unique and intimate perspective on the life of Walter, a convicted child molester who is released from prison after serving a 12-year sentence. As Walter grapples with his dark past and attempts to reintegrate into society, audiences are taken on an emotional journey filled with raw performances and intense storytelling. The Woodsman is a psychological drama film

Released in 2004, The Woodsman is a thought-provoking movie that delves into the psyche of its troubled protagonist.

The movie stars Kevin Bacon

Kevin Bacon delivers a captivating performance as Walter, a man who struggles with his past actions as a convicted child molester.

It explores the themes of redemption and forgiveness

The Woodsman raises compelling questions about whether someone with a dark past can truly be redeemed and forgiven for their actions.

The film is based on a play by Steven Fechter

The Woodsman was adapted from the critically acclaimed off-Broadway play of the same name, written by Steven Fechter.

Nicole Kassell directed the movie

Nicole Kassell helmed the film adaptation, bringing her unique vision and directorial style to the project.

It received positive reviews from critics

The Woodsman garnered praise for its powerful performances, sensitive handling of its subject matter, and thought-provoking narrative.

The movie premiered at the Sundance Film Festival

The Woodsman made its debut at the prestigious Sundance Film Festival, where it gained attention for its compelling storytelling.

The film’s cast includes Kyra Sedgwick

Kyra Sedgwick plays the role of Vicki, a woman who strikes up an unexpected bond with Walter.

It was shot in and around Philadelphia

The Woodsman was primarily filmed on location in Philadelphia, adding an authentic touch to the story.

The movie received several award nominations

The Woodsman was recognized for its outstanding performances and screenplay, earning nominations at various award ceremonies.

The screenplay was written by Nicole Kassell and Steven Fechter

Nicole Kassell collaborated with Steven Fechter to adapt his play into a compelling screenplay for the film.

Q: What is “The Woodsman” about?

A: “The Woodsman” is a movie that follows the story of Walter, a convicted pedophile who returns to society after serving a prison sentence. The film explores his struggle to reconcile with his disturbing past, his yearning for redemption, and his attempts to live a reformed life.

Q: Who stars in “The Woodsman”?

A: The movie features an exceptional cast, including Kevin Bacon as Walter, Kyra Sedgwick as Vicki, Eve as Mary-Kay, and Benjamin Bratt as Carlos.

Q: Is “The Woodsman” based on a true story?

A: No, “The Woodsman” is not based on a true story. However, it portrays the psychological journey and inner turmoil of individuals with similar experiences in a sensitive and thought-provoking manner.
